Acerca de From Other to Center

In this podcast, we explore the role of ancestral identity in finding belonging and embodying our full selves. I’m your host Aysha Jamali, a South Asian media artist and storyteller. Who am I? Where do I come from? What makes me feel like I belong? These are questions I think about a lot. I’m also really curious about how others connect to their ancestral identities and move from a place of being othered to being centered. In this podcast, I’ll be talking with people who are doing just that and hearing about all of the different ways they get there.

Portada del episodio Capturing the Bangladeshi diaspora through embroidered portraits

Capturing the Bangladeshi diaspora through embroidered portraits

In this episode of From Other to Center, I sit down with Bangladeshi-American fiber artist Fatema Haque to ask her how she finds belonging through her art. For her ‘Bangladeshis in Michigan’ fiber art exhibit, Fatema sourced photos from her Bangladeshi community—and her own family—to create stunning, hand-embroidered portraits. Her portraits and the oral histories she gathered capture the experiences of multiple generations of her community. Fatema shares with me how her art gives her the opportunity to represent the Bangladeshi diaspora, hold space for grief, and find healing and belonging. Follow us on Instagram!
